Christian Éthier is an Associate Professor in the Department of Psychiatry and Neuroscience at the Faculty of Medicine, Université Laval. His research focuses on understanding and leveraging neuronal plasticity to repair neural circuits after injury or stroke, particularly through neuroprosthetics and brain-computer interfaces.
- Current position: Associate Professor, Université Laval
- Research focus: Neuronal plasticity, motor recovery, neuroelectronic interfaces
- Lab affiliation: Ethier Lab
Dr. Éthier investigates how electrochemical neuronal activity modulates neural connections, aiming to develop neuroprostheses that restore motor function in paralyzed patients. His work bridges engineering and neuroscience, emphasizing cortical and spinal motor network reorganization.
Recent publications highlight collaborations in wireless electro-optic platforms for optogenetics, corticospinal excitability studies, and neurostimulation applications for stroke rehabilitation. His lab at Université Laval, part of the CERVO Brain Research Centre, specializes in neuroprosthetic devices tested in primate and rodent models.
Dr. Éthier’s team explores methods to guide neural reorganization using electrical/optical stimulation, targeting impairments from spinal cord injuries.
